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Better Home & Finance Holding Co executive Chad M. Smith, President & COO of Better Mortgage, reported a mix of stock sales, tax‑related share withholdings, and RSU vesting in Class A common stock.

On March 15, 2026, restricted stock units representing 4,834 shares were exercised into Class A common stock at a $0.00 conversion price, increasing his direct holdings. To cover taxes on RSU vesting, the issuer withheld 2,266 shares on March 13, 2026 at $32.90 per share and 2,460 shares on March 16, 2026 at $34.45 per share; these are tax-withholding dispositions, not market sales.

Separately, a trust associated with Smith executed open‑market sales of 2,567 shares on March 16, 2026 at a weighted average price of $29.8025 per share, and 2,374 shares on March 17, 2026 at a weighted average price of $28.5131 per share, across price ranges disclosed in the footnotes. After these transactions, the filing shows 4,941 shares held directly and 18,575 shares held indirectly through a trust.

Explanation of Responses:
1. Represents shares of Class A common stock withheld to pay taxes upon vesting of restricted stock units held by the Reporting Person, which vesting occured on March 1, 2026. The number of shares withheld was determined on March 13, 2026, based on the closing price of the Issuer's Class A common stock on February 27, 2026.
2. The price reported in Column 4 is a weighted average price for shares sold in multiple transactions. The sale prices range from $29.70 to $30.04 per share. The reporting person has provided to the issuer, and undertakes to provide to the staff of the Securities and Exchange Commission or any security holder of the issuer, upon request, full information regarding the number of shares sold at each separate price within the range.
3. Represents shares of Class A common stock withheld to pay taxes upon the vesting of restricted stock units held by the Reporting Person, which vesting occured on March 15, 2026. The number of shares withheld was determined on March 16, 2026, based on the closing price of the Issuer's Class A common stock on March 13, 2026.
4. The price reported in Column 4 is a weighted average price for shares sold in multiple transactions. The sale prices range from $28.20 to $28.77 per share. The reporting person has provided to the issuer, and undertakes to provide to the staff of the Securities and Exchange Commission or any security holder of the issuer, upon request, full information regarding the number of shares sold at each separate price within the range.
5. Each restricted stock unit represents a contingent right to receive one share of the Issuer's Class A Common Stock.
6. The restricted stock units will vest with respect to (i) 3/12ths of such restricted stock units on July 1, 2025, (ii) 8/12ths of such restricted stock units in equal monthly installments beginning on August 1, 2025 through March 1, 2026, and (iii) the remaining 1/12th of such restricted stock units on March 15, 2026.
